Where is that stated? I've checked in the MPLS Architecture documents,
searching with the "bidirectional" and "bi-directional" keywords, and I
haven't been able to find it mentioned.
On the other hand, the two applicability documents for CR-LDP and RSVP-TE both
state that bi-directional LSP set up is not yet supported:
Applicability Statement for CR-LDP (13805 bytes):
"CR-LDP specification only supports unidirectional LSP setup.
Bi-directional LSP setup is FFS."
Applicability Statement for Extensions to RSVP for LSP-Tunnels (16573 bytes):
"The RSVP-TE specification supports only unidirectional LSP- tunnels.
Bidirectional LSP-tunnels are not supported."

> Hello,
>
> I have a question about MPLS and ATM. ATM point-to-point PVCs can be
> either uni-directional or bi-directional. MPLS LSPs are only
> uni-directional. Is there any work being done concerning bi-directional
> LSPs, for example, to allow two LSPs to be established by a single RSVP
> signalling operation?
